CVE-2025-6000
CVE-2025-6000
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- High
- User Interaction
- None
- Scope
- Changed
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
A privileged Vault operator within the root namespace with write permission to {{sys/audit}} may obtain code execution on the underlying host if a plugin directory is set in Vault’s configuration. Fixed in Vault Community Edition 1.20.1 and Vault Enterprise 1.20.1, 1.19.7, 1.18.12, and 1.16.23.
Comprehensive Technical Analysis of CVE-2025-6000
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2025-6000 CVSS Score: 9.1
The vulnerability described in CVE-2025-6000 is critical, as indicated by its high CVSS score of 9.1. This score reflects the potential for severe impact, including unauthorized code execution on the underlying host system. The vulnerability allows a privileged Vault operator within the root namespace, who has write permission to the {{sys/audit}} endpoint, to execute arbitrary code if a plugin directory is configured in Vault’s settings.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Privileged Access: An attacker must have privileged access to the Vault root namespace and write permissions to the
{{sys/audit}}endpoint. - Plugin Directory Configuration: The vulnerability is exploitable only if a plugin directory is set in Vault’s configuration.
Exploitation Methods:
- Code Injection: An attacker with the necessary permissions can inject malicious code into the plugin directory, leading to arbitrary code execution on the host system.
- Privilege Escalation: The attacker can leverage this vulnerability to escalate privileges, potentially gaining full control over the host system.
3. Affected Systems and Software Versions
Affected Versions:
- Vault Community Edition: Versions prior to 1.20.1
- Vault Enterprise: Versions prior to 1.20.1, 1.19.7, 1.18.12, and 1.16.23
Systems at Risk:
- Any system running the affected versions of Vault with a configured plugin directory.
- Systems where privileged Vault operators have write access to the
{{sys/audit}}endpoint.
4. Recommended Mitigation Strategies
Immediate Actions:
- Upgrade Vault: Upgrade to the patched versions: Vault Community Edition 1.20.1, Vault Enterprise 1.20.1, 1.19.7, 1.18.12, or 1.16.23.
- Restrict Permissions: Limit write permissions to the
{{sys/audit}}endpoint to trusted operators only. - Disable Plugin Directory: If not necessary, disable the plugin directory configuration in Vault.
Long-Term Strategies:
- Regular Audits: Conduct regular security audits and vulnerability assessments.
- Access Control: Implement strict access control policies and monitor privileged accounts closely.
- Patch Management: Establish a robust patch management process to ensure timely updates and patches.
5. Impact on Cybersecurity Landscape
The discovery of CVE-2025-6000 underscores the importance of securing privileged access and configuration settings in critical infrastructure tools like HashiCorp Vault. This vulnerability highlights the potential risks associated with misconfigurations and the need for continuous monitoring and updating of security practices. Organizations must prioritize the security of their secret management solutions to prevent unauthorized access and potential data breaches.
6. Technical Details for Security Professionals
Technical Overview:
- Vault Configuration: The vulnerability is triggered by the presence of a plugin directory in Vault’s configuration. This directory is used to load custom plugins, which can be exploited if malicious code is injected.
- Audit Endpoint: The
{{sys/audit}}endpoint is used for configuring audit devices in Vault. Write permissions to this endpoint allow an attacker to manipulate audit settings and potentially inject malicious code.
Detection and Response:
- Log Monitoring: Monitor Vault logs for any suspicious activities related to the
{{sys/audit}}endpoint. - Intrusion Detection: Implement intrusion detection systems (IDS) to detect and alert on any unauthorized access or code injection attempts.
- Incident Response: Develop an incident response plan specifically for Vault-related vulnerabilities, including steps for containment, eradication, and recovery.
Conclusion: CVE-2025-6000 represents a significant risk to organizations using HashiCorp Vault for secret management. Immediate action is required to mitigate this vulnerability, including upgrading to patched versions and implementing strict access controls. Continuous monitoring and regular security audits are essential to maintain the integrity and security of critical infrastructure components.